What does mbH mean in HVAC?
What is heating capacity MBH? MBH = thousand BTU's per hour. It is a measure of the size of air conditioning system in the traditional Imperial System of measurements. One BTU is the amount of energy necessary to raise the temperature of one pound of water from 60F to 61F.

What is MBH in boiler rating?
MBH = 1,000 BTU/hr. PPH = Pounds of steam per hour. Gross Rating – The full output of a boiler actually available to the heating or process system at the outlet nozzle.

How do you measure MBH?
Divide the amount of Btus per hour by 1,000 to calculate the amount of MBH. For example, the amount of Btus per hour is 20,000. Dividing that by 1,000 would result in 20 MBH. Multiply the amount of watts by 0.293 to calculate the amount of MBH.Apr 24, 2017

What is BTU/hr?
BTU is how much heat is produced at one instant, BTU/hr is the amount of heat produced in an hour. MBH is 1000 BTU/hr. However, BTU is sometimes used as an equivalent to BTU/hr, so the conversion might work. Wikipedia has an article that might clear things up.

What was the difference between a boiler's net output and its gross output in 1940?
In 1940, the factor that manufacturers used to designate the difference between a boiler's Net Output and the Gross Output was 1.56. In other words, you figured out the building's heat loss. Then you selected your radiators to overcome that heat loss.
